CY7C1514KV18-250BZXI
CY7C1514KV18-250BZXI is a high-performance QDR II+ SRAM (Quad Data Rate Static Random Access Memory) produced by Cypress Semiconductor (now Infineon Technologies). Below are its key parameters and application scenarios:
Key Parameters:
- Type: QDR II+ SRAM (Quad Data Rate SRAM)
- Capacity: 72Mb (4M x 18-bit)
- Speed: 250MHz (data rate up to 500Mbps)
- Interface: Dual-port (independent read/write ports)
- Operating Voltage: 1.8V
- Package: 165-ball BGA (Ball Grid Array)
- Operating Temperature: -40°C to +105°C (industrial grade)
- Features:
- Supports burst read/write operations.
- Low latency and high bandwidth.
- Independent read/write data buses, enabling simultaneous read/write operations.
- Suitable for high-performance computing and networking applications.
Application Scenarios:
CY7C1514KV18-250BZXI is a high-performance memory primarily used in scenarios requiring high bandwidth and low latency. Below are its typical applications:
1. Networking Equipment
- Function: Used for high-speed packet buffering and queue management.
- Applications:
- Packet processing in routers, switches, and gateways.
- Network traffic management and QoS (Quality of Service) control.
- High-speed data caching and forwarding.

Advantages:
- High Bandwidth: Data rates up to 500Mbps, suitable for high-speed data processing.
- Low Latency: Fast response time, ideal for real-time applications.
- Dual-Port Design: Supports simultaneous read/write operations, improving system efficiency.
- High Reliability: Industrial temperature range, suitable for harsh environments.
- Low Power Consumption: 1.8V operating voltage, suitable for energy-efficient designs.
